Mechanical Engineer - Switzerland

This innovative PEMFC business is challenging the energy sector with an innovative fuel cell technology to disrupt conventional sources of power - are you the right person to join this dynamic and growing team?

This business is developing cutting-edge fuel cell technology for heavy duty mobility and large-scale stationary power applications. Their uniquely redesigned product is a significantly more compact fuel cell with high power density, greater efficiencies and lower costs of production. Faced with the challenges of climate change and the transition to a decentralized energy system, they seek to provide high performance and cost-effective fuel cell solutions to their clients and partners. To help achieve their vision of a decarbonised future they are seeking a highly talented and motivated Mechanical Engineer with strong background in fuel cells.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Development of mechanical activities at the fuel cell systems and products level by applying principles of mechanics, thermodynamics, hydraulics and heat transfer engineering
  • Design, implement and validate various solutions for engineering tasks
  • Propose new ideas for fuel cell system design and optimisation of components
  • Provide technical input in discussions with internal and external stakeholders
  • Collaborate with other team members regarding system design, interfaces and functionalities
  • Participate in various hands-on activities in the labs 
  • Liaise with suppliers and procurement of new components and solutions
  • Prepare reports on failure mode and analysis, test plans and presentations for internal and external stakeholders

Skills and Experience Required:

  • PhD, MSc/BSc level or equivalent in Mechanical or related disciplines
  • Knowledge and experience in fuel cell and its applications is mandatory
  • At least 2-3 years of previous working experience in the field of fuel cells is mandatory
  • In-depth understanding and implementation skills of thermodynamic and physics principles
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ced changing environment with the possibility of changing priorities
  • Experience with a 3D CAD software such as SolidWORKS
  • Strong communication skills with internal and external customers
  • Team player with the ability to function autonomously
  • Good understanding of design and risk analysis tools such as FMEA and DFMEA
  • Experience with Product Data Management (PDM) system management is a plus
  • Excellent spoken and written knowledge of English is mandatory
  • Good written and spoken knowledge of French, German or other languages is preferable
